Santa Margarita is a 3rd-class Municipality in the province of Samar, Eastern Visayas (Region VIII), Philippines. Based on 2024 PSA data, it has a population of 27,012 residents.

Local Food in Santa Margarita

Culinary specialties documented in Santa Margarita and Samar.

Kinilaw na Tambakol

Fresh-caught yellowfin tuna from the Samar Sea, cured in tuba (coconut vinegar) with ginger, chili, and sometimes coconut cream for extra body.

Inun-unan na Isda

A Samar staple; fish simmered in vinegar, ginger, and turmeric. The Samar version often includes batwan for a specific, localized acidity.

Gabi (Taro) in Gata

Using the abundant wild taro of the Samar forests, cooked with thick coconut milk, dried fish, and siling haba for a creamy, spicy heat.

Pusit na Pinatuyo

Sun-dried squid, a product of the long coastlines, often fried until crispy and served with a vinegar dip as a pulutan or side.

Santa Margarita in the Philippine Administrative System

Santa Margarita is classified as a municipality under the Philippine Standard Geographic Code (PSGC) system, assigned the identifier 0806016000. This code is used by national agencies including the Philippine Statistics Authority, the Commission on Elections, and the Department of the Interior and Local Government for census reporting, electoral mapping, and administrative tracking.

As a Local Government Unit (LGU), Santa Margarita is governed by an elected mayor and a Sangguniang Bayan or Sangguniang Panlungsod responsible for local ordinances, the annual budget, and local services. The LGU is composed of 36 barangays, each led by an elected Punong Barangay.

Santa Margarita is one of the cities and municipalities forming the province of Samar in Eastern Visayas.
